Transaction 50ac4764b8d8911103678dcb34e60b08b8fbbb7ce80800bd4f8aea362be18e40
1 Input
2 Outputs
- 50ac4764b8d8911103678dcb34e60b08b8fbbb7ce80800bd4f8aea362be18e40:0
- 50ac4764b8d8911103678dcb34e60b08b8fbbb7ce80800bd4f8aea362be18e40:1
value 390580
address 3AmQyZtR68gtrneuBFWCXwsL65PhsZQjs3
value 24856954
address 3C63qx6UyCSji9GDTPFu3JFTSnLKtZo91r